Django Unchained

Django Unchained is the next film by the legendary director and writer Quentin Tarantino(Pulp Fiction). The film is about a slave and who is given his freedom by a Bounty Hunter to find these three bothers who have a huge bounty on there heads. When they do this they bound and Django(the slave) wants to go save his wife's life. The bounty hunter agrees to help him do this and now we have Django Unchained.

I am going to start off the review saying that Quentin Tarantino is my personal favorite director so take everything I say with a gain of salt. Now to start off the review I want to talk about the acting in the film. Jamie Foxx, Christoph Waltz, and Leonardo DiCaprio pay for your ticket alone. I loved the characters that Tarantino wrote for these guys. DiCaprio was one of the worst human beings I have ever seen in a film and I loved him for that. Waltz was a great character and just fit the role perfectly. Then Foxx really impressed me. He want form not saying much and not being very smart to this complete BA by the end of the film. The way this film was shot was classic Tarantino's fast zoom and well angled and great moving camera shots when they are talking I loved every minute it. The tone and pace that Tarantino does is perfect there is not one scene were I was like that wasn't really needed. He mix's comedy and this so super tense scenes so well together its crazy. This film is what I really wanted Inglourious Basterds to be. This was felt more like a older Tarantino movie with a huge budget. The script in this film was for lack of a better world perfect. It has all those things that we love about Tarantino which is his great dialogue and these really well done characters. He is was able to mix the style of a western and his style great. Also the are parts in the beginning where it almost feels like a buddy cop movie for a bit not to long, but I totally saw that.

This is easily the best and the most fun I have had in a movie in a long time the last time I had this much  fun in a movie was The Avengers. So that being said I need to talk about a few other things. The movie is being called racist and super violent and bloody. Well yes this film is very violent I meant almost Kill Bill violent. So you have been given the heads up about that. As to it being racist it isn't really racist they just really tried to make it time relevant which I thought really worked for the film. So this all still being said I still had a great time at the movies and highly recommend that everyone of the 17 or older to see this film. So of course I give it


RATING
5 out of 5 ticket stubs

Les Miserables (2012)

Les Miserables is a play that was made into a musical that got turned into a movie now that it is all said and done, the film is about a criminal named Jean Valjean played by Wol I mean Hugh Jackman. Who wants to become a better man after he has had this single act of kindness done on to him. So now he feels that he must help others.

This film has a lot of stuff to talk about. One being the acting done by everybody. All the actors are spot on in this film. Hugh Jackman and Anne Hathaway both deserve nods this year. Anne Hathaway was so good in this film she had some great scenes like the I dreamed a dream song which was so good. I mean tears. Then Jackman is just great all the way thought this film. I don't think he has a bad scene which is good because he is the movie to me. Also the direction done by Tom Hooper (King's Speech) was really good he hits this perfect tone that never really lets up. Also the cinematography was so good he likes to do this sweeping shots that really show off the landscape of the world he has created. The singing was good in the most part. Everybody except for one did great. Hugh Jackman really impressed me I knew he was a good singer but man he is really good. Also something else that needs to be talked about. That is most movies that have singing in it make it with the singing prerecorded and the they just over dub and this film they didn't do that. They actually sing on camera so all that emotion they are giving at that time they are also working on singing. Which really just blows my mind and really adds to the film. This leads in to the music this includes the score and the songs they sing they are both very good, best I have heard all year.

Now on to what I didn't like about this film. It is really slow. I feel like there is a theme going with the last few movies that I have seen. I wasn't the hobbit slow, but i think there is something they could have done to help movie the film movie along a little faster. Also there is a ton of singing in this film. Yeah that may be stupid reading that, but like 99% of the film is singing and if they do speak its a line tops. So I have to put that in the negative column. So if your worried your not gonna like it because there is singing stay far away my friends far away. Then to talk about the thing that is kinda the elephant in the room Russell Crowe. Maximus Decimus Meridius isn't the worlds best singer. I not saying Rebecca Black bad, but no where on pair with Hugh Jackman and the others. So for those reasons I have to give the rating of

RATING
4 out of 5 Ticket Stubs

The Hobbit

The Hobbit is Peter Jackson's return to the realm of middle earth. It is the prequel series to the great and super popular Lord of the Rings trilogy.  This story is about a the dwarves and how they want to kill the evil dragon smaug, but they need the help of a hobbit of the name of Bilbo Baggins. Now I have been a big fan of the series as a kid. So I was expecting a lot form this film. I am going to do my best not compare this to the rings and not spoil.

The Hobbit has a ton things that I need to talk about,  so lets get this review started. The acting in this film is good. No real Oscar performances but they all work on the screen. Martin Freeman plays the main character of Bilbo and he is great really enjoyed his character all the way. Then you also have Sir Ian McKellen returns as the Gandalf the grey and he really shines in this film. I liked him more in this then I liked him in the rings. Also I note worthy performance is the actor that nobody eyes Andy Serkis playing Gollum. Gollum to me was the best part of this whole film the riddles in the dark scene was great and the CGI they did for Gollum was amazing. He looked so real and the performance done by Serkis just adds so much depth to the character.

Now on to what I didn't like. This film was dreadfully slow. The film clocks in just under 3 hours and the first 2 hours really suffer. Nothing really happens and the story really doesn't get pushed forward. Now I am not saying that Jackson did a bad job at directing this film but, the fact that this was meant to be a 2 movie in the beginning and recently got changed may have hurt the film. Also there was far to much CGI in this film. Now its not like Avatar CGI bad, but what I wanted to see was all the cool evil looking orcs in flesh. Also the are total of 15 characters in the company and its very hard to keep track of who they are. You don't really get stuck on any of the characters.

Now the last hour of this film was really good full of action and really pushing the story forward. The film really picks up at like right before they get to Riverdale. I would also like to talk about one of the characters called Radagast the Brown he is being called the JarJar of the Hobbit. He isn't that bad. I just didn't care for the character. On the whole thought this film really let me down. With the poor pacing and the poorly done CGI. Also the story isn't as good as the rings in my opinion. So it hardens my heart to give this score but

RATING
3.5 out of 5 Ticket Stubs
